Nikkei falls over 2 pct to below 17,000

Tokyo, Apr 24: The Nikkei average fell more than 2 percent to below 17,000 on Monday, as a rise in the yen hurt Toyota Motor Corp. and other exporters.

Electronics conglomerate NEC Corp. sank 4.6 percent to 833 yen following its profit warning late last week, and robot maker Fanuc Ltd. fell almost 2 percent ahead of its annual earnings due after the market closes.

The Nikkei average was down 2.34 percent or 407.11 points at 16,996.85 as of 0035 GMT. The TOPIX index was down 1.96 percent at 1,722.04.

Nepal rebels attack town, no word on casualties

KATHMANDU, Apr 24 (Reuters) Hundreds of Maoist rebels stormed a town in eastern Nepal and fought a six-hour gun battle with security forces, a senior government official today said. He said communication links had been cut with the town of Chautara, about 100 km east of the capital Kathmandu, and there was no word yet on casualties. High oil, weak dollar push gold up

SYDNEY, Apr 24 (Reuters) Investors lapped up more gold on Monday, boosting bullion prices by more than $1 as oil prices held firm and the U.S. dollar slipped, keeping inflation concerns alive. ''We're seeing a bit more interest in gold compared with Friday,'' a gold dealer in Sydney said.
